I'm gradually getting back into my diet & exercise routine but have noticed that I feel nauseous when I'm eating healthier. Finally meeting my protein goals and lowered my carb intake. I thought maybe I wasn't getting enough water but I've been staying hydrated lately and it's still an issue (definitely not pregnant lol).. Does anybody else experience this, am I missing something or am I just crazy?

    Could be the protein. Increasing it too quickly or eating a lot of protein at one meal can cause stomach issues for me.
